Proposed deficit budget garners little to no pushback from Waukegan aldermen – Chicago Tribune

April 23, 2019 No Comments

That shortfall is expected to come in higher than projected because of higher costs in a council-approved union contract and lower than expected revenues. The general fund is projected to run a $3.5 million deficit due to a flat property tax levy, falling sales and income tax revenue, and climbing expenses driven in large part by contract-mandated raises.

Illinois’ ‘tax hike budget’ gets low marks on state budgeting from Volcker Alliance – Chicago Tribune

April 23, 2019 No Comments

The nonprofit Volcker Alliance gave Illinois mostly “D” grades and a “D-” in its state-by-state assessment of 2018 fiscal year’s governmental performance. The “D-” was for legacy costs. It’s the lowest mark the nonprofit uses.
